=== Memphis Grizzlies Team Report - December 31 === (My Sportsbook) - The Memphis Grizzlies lost to the Seattle SuperSonics, 105-99, on Tuesday at The Pyramid. Pau Gasol was a one-man gang with 32 points and 11 rebounds for the Grizzlies, who have lost seven in a row. Memphis guard Bonzi Wells missed the game, as he is still suffering from the effects of the concussion he suffered on Monday at Indiana. After an alley-oop from Earl Watson to Dahntay Jones gave Memphis an 80-78 edge 2 1/2 minutes into the fourth, the Sonics ran off nine straight points to jump back into the lead for good. Rashard Lewis and Ray Allen made back-to- back threes to ignite the run that put Seattle up 87-80. A three-point play by Lewis closed out the spurt. Gasol converted two free throws with 1:24 left to get Memphis within 98-95, but a dunk by Lewis with 26 ticks left made it 103-97, putting the exclamation point on the win. Memphis activated Jones and put guard Troy Bell on the injured list prior to the game. The Grizzlies are off until Friday when they host Matt Harpring and the Utah Jazz.
